Analysis

Gambia recorded 43.22 for proportion tariff lines applied to imports from ldcs in 2023.

The figure is down 43.9% on the previous year and down 37.9% over ten years.

Over the whole period, proportion tariff lines applied to imports from ldcs in Gambia peaked at 80.11 in 2020 and was at its lowest, 30.96, in 2010.

Gambia ranks 197th of 221 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 11 years of available data.
